Though Bing may not be the most popular search engine, it has its own set of advantages that entice online marketers and businesses, a few of them are highlighted below:
1) Comparatively cheap and less competitive
Advertising on Bing is a
different story. The competition among bidders is mild, and the CPC bid is
cheaper than Google Ads. For the same search term bid, you will be charged a
lesser amount on Bing, and due to the low competition among advertisers, you
have more chances of great ad placement.
2) Bing allows you to take charge of the campaign at the ad group level
Google Ads offers
changes only at the campaign level, and ad groups are limited to defined
settings. It is indeed taxing; if you need to alter these parameters, you must
set up a new campaign. Bing provides far more control and alteration at the ad
group level. You can set different locations, languages, ad schedules and
rotation settings for various ad groups. This aids digital marketers in deeply
targeting desired audiences and fine-tuning every ad for specified search
terms.
3) Crystal-clear search partner information
Bing does not believe in
concealing its search partners. You can target searches on Bing and Yahoo or on
search partners or on both as you please. You can drop search partners that are
not producing adequate results and add new partners you think have potential.
Google Adwords does not reveal its search partners, which also rules out the
ability to exclude unwanted partners.
4) Connect easily through social extensions
Social extensions can be
placed under the ad copy. They allow prospects to connect and communicate with
the advertiser on social channels like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, etc. Upon
clicking the social extension, the searcher is taken to the social profile or
post. To add credibility to an advertisement, Bing also shows the advertiser’s
Twitter followers.
5) Demographic targeting
Google Ads does not
allow you to target search engine advertisements demographically. However, Bing
empowers advertisers to set the age and gender of their target audience so that
the ad appears only to those who meet these criteria. This considerably
enhances the ad’s performance and conversion rates.
